Watlow PM PLUS™ 6 • 106 • Chapter 9: Applications
Example 1: Single Loop Control
Requirements: One input is required and at least one output adjusts the controlled part of the process.
Overview: Controls one process value to a user entered Set Point based on an control algorithm.
Control loop 1 will control Analog Input 1 to Set Point 1.
Example 2: Sensor Backup
Requirements: Two analog inputs and the enhanced software option are required and at least one output adjusts
the controlled part of the process.
Overview: The Sensor Backup feature controls a process based on a primary sensor on Analog Input 1. If this
sensor fails, then the process is controlled based on the secondary sensor on Analog Input 2.
When function is set for Sensor Backup, the PV Function output equals Source A if sensor of Analog Input 1
reading is valid or Source B if sensor reading is invalid. Control loop 1 will control the valid Analog Input sensor
to Set Point 1.
